Notes
Studio recording for 'Any Way You Want It' (Departure, 1980; 2024 Remaster is from this session). Neal Schon is known for using a Les Paul Standard into a Marshall JMP 2203 for this era. No evidence of live/touring gear or other guitars for the main riff. Effects chain includes flanger pedal, confirmed by Equipboard and audible in the recording.
